#49c1f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49c1f2 is composed of 28.6% red, 75.7%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 197.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 61.8%. #49c1f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#0083e5.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#49c1f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49c1f2 has RGB values of R:73, G:193,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4833778.

Shades and Tints of #49c1f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#49c1f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9ea0 is the less saturated color, while #42c4fa is the most saturated one.
